SB 79 Michigan Senate · 2025-2026 Regular Session

Highways: memorial; portion of M-150; designate as the "William S. Broomfield Memorial Highway". Amends 2001 PA 142 (MCL 250.1001 - 250.2092) by adding sec. 109.

This bill designates a specific 2.5-mile segment of M-150 in Oakland County (from Tienken Road south to M-59) as the "William S. Broomfield Memorial Highway." It directly affects highway signage and official state records for this location. The bill amends Michigan's memorial highway law to add this specific naming, honoring William S. Broomfield. As a procedural naming bill, it does not change transportation policy or funding.
